Output 68d13e804de9ca425406eba879f5a20a8047e2009132446292b44e7fa4dcfc5d: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4facd69e7a7e353c9f6e3f95974610ba847b103 OP_EQUALVERIFY OP_CHECKSIG
address
1MsjWo1yoBqAhUsff2ydNsdu5S9EAZvaLh
transaction
68d13e804de9ca425406eba879f5a20a8047e2009132446292b44e7fa4dcfc5d
confirmations
586776
spent
true